Kuwait to issue 3-month visas

Published October 3, 2004

KUWAIT CITY, Oct 2: Kuwait will issue visit visas from October this year for tourists that will last for three months.

This was stated by the undersecretary for security services at the Kuwait s interior ministry.

Major General Thabet Al Muhanna told journalists that according to new procedure, the three months tourist visas would be issued to the citizen of 34 countries.

Al Muhanna also told journalists the cabinet was considering allowing conversion of visit visa to a work permit.
